Salaries for fire science professionals in Monterey Park have increased. In 2010 Monterey Park fire science professionals earned an average yearly salary of $65,830. Fire science professionals in Monterey Park made a yearly average salary of $55,685, four years earlier in 2006. This growth is faster than the salary trend for all careers in Monterey Park.

Fire science professionals in Monterey Park earn a median salary of $66,220 per year. The 10% of fire science professionals in the lowest pay bracket earn less than $42,185 per year, while those in the highest pay bracket earn approximately $89,005 per year.
